How they compare
Brunei Darussalam currently reports 12.5% against 12.2% in Dominican Republic,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Dominican Republic ahead.
Brunei Darussalam ranks 66th and Dominican Republic ranks 69th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Brunei Darussalam averaged higher in 5 and Dominican Republic in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Brunei Darussalam | Dominican Republic |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 11.4% | 10.5% | 0.9% | Brunei Darussalam |
| 1970s | 14.3% | 6.1% | 8.2% | Brunei Darussalam |
| 1980s | 17.3% | 11.6% | 5.7% | Brunei Darussalam |
| 1990s | 18.1% | 16.3% | 1.8% | Brunei Darussalam |
| 2000s | 3.4% | 19.3% | 15.9% | Dominican Republic |
| 2010s | 12.5% | 12.2% | 0.3% | Brunei Darussalam |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
